COLOMBIA Consular Air Post - A (Germany)
1921 Registration Handstamps, 20c red brown, handstamped with red "R" type II on 20c (1921) with large "A" handstamp, used with 3x30c with large "A" and German franking (invalidated) on registered coverfront, originating from Ohligs, via Barranquilla July 26, 1923 to Medellin, fine and rare combination surcharge
Price Realized
$550.00

COLOMBIA Consular Air Post - A (Germany)
1923 Germany, six covers, four franked with typographed "A" overprints on different values, used in combination with German stamps, or all Colombian Scadta franking, one showing extensive handstamp in Spanish explaining the new routes, plus 1928 and 1929 covers from Hamburg and Dortmund to Bogotá, with regular German stamps, as Scadta stamps were not required after November 15, 1927, some faults, mostly fine
Envelope
Price Realized
$450.00

COLOMBIA Consular Air Post - A (Germany)
1923 Germany, Typographed "A" overprints on 10c and 5peso, used on business size envelope from Berlin, with German franking, all tied by January 21, 1927 departure pmks, with Barranquilla and Bogotá arrival (March 2), some toning, with Scadta labels, plus transit and arrival pmks on back, fine and very rare cover with 5peso
Envelope
Price Realized
$900.00
